Description

Scanning gun with area identification function
Technical Field
The utility model relates to a scanning rifle technical field especially relates to a take regional recognition function's scanning rifle.
Background
The scanning gun can be applied to the technologies of optics, mechanics, electronics, software application and the like, and is a main modern computer input device. Such as pictures, photos, films and various drawings and manuscript data can be input into a computer by a scanning gun, and then the processing, management, use, storage or output of the image information is realized. At present, the scanning rifle in the market is used for more receiving silver-colored operation, and current scanning rifle is connected with the computer for the convenience of using, uses more uses wireless mode, nevertheless in the use of wireless scanning rifle, can not in time charge to the scanning rifle, and the condition of outage takes place for easy in use, influences the efficiency of scanning admission work. Through retrieval, the Chinese patent with the publication number of CN207663451U discloses a novel identification scanning gun, which comprises a scanning gun body and a fixed base, wherein the scanning gun body is positioned above the fixed base and is detachably connected with the fixed base; the scanning gun body comprises a scanning head, a handheld handle and a scanning base, the handheld handle is positioned between the scanning head and the scanning base, the top of the handheld handle is fixedly connected with the scanning head, and the bottom of the handheld handle is fixedly connected with the scanning base; the fixed base comprises a fixed clamping groove and an adsorption bottom plate, the fixed clamping groove is located on the surface of the adsorption bottom plate, the fixed clamping groove is fixedly connected with the adsorption bottom plate, and the fixed clamping groove is connected with the scanning base in a matched mode. Through being furnished with unable adjustment base for the scanning rifle body, be convenient for on the one hand support the scanning rifle body, take when facilitating the use, on the other hand makes the scanning rifle body in time charge in the clearance of work, improves the operating time of the scanning rifle body to improve the scanning.
But still have the shortcoming in the above-mentioned design, fix the scanning gun on unable adjustment base through magnetic adsorption in the above-mentioned design, fixed stability is relatively poor, takes place the mistake easily and bumps and drop, causes unnecessary economic loss, therefore we have proposed a scanning gun of area identification function in the area and is used for solving above-mentioned problem.

Drawings
Fig. 1 is a schematic view of a main view structure of a scanning gun with a region identification function according to the present invention;
fig. 2 is a schematic cross-sectional structural view of a scanning gun with a region identification function according to the present invention;
fig. 3 is a schematic structural diagram of a part a of a scanning gun with a region identification function according to the present invention.
In the figure: 1. scanning the gun body; 2. a fixed base; 3. a charging head; 4. a charging plug board; 5. a charging slot; 6. a vertical groove; 7. a baffle plate; 8. a support spring; 9. a guide bar; 10. a suction cup; 11. a transverse slot; 12. a vertical plate; 13. a clamping rod; 14. a card slot; 15. a sloping plate; 16. sheathing; 17. a button; 18. a vertical hole; 19. a fixing plate; 20. a return spring.
Detailed Description
The technical solutions in the embodiments of the present invention will be described clearly and completely with reference to the accompanying drawings in the embodiments of the present invention, and it is obvious that the described embodiments are only some embodiments of the present invention, not all embodiments.
Referring to fig. 1-3, a scanning gun with area recognition function comprises a scanning gun body 1 and a fixed base 2, the scanning gun body 1 is placed on the top of the fixed base 2, a charging socket 4 is fixedly installed on one side of the top of the fixed base 2, the bottom of one side of the scanning gun body 1 is movably abutted with one side of the charging socket 4 and is fixedly installed with a charging head 3, one side of the charging socket 4 is provided with a charging slot 5, the charging head 3 is movably connected with the charging slot 5, the top of the fixed base 2 is provided with a vertical groove 6, a baffle 7 is slidably installed in the vertical groove 6, the baffle 7 is movably abutted with the other side of the scanning gun body 1, the bottom of the baffle 7 is fixedly connected with one end of two supporting springs 8, the other end of the two supporting springs 8 is fixedly connected on the inner wall of the bottom of the vertical groove 6, a, a clamping rod 13 is fixedly mounted at the top of one side of the vertical plate 12, a clamping groove 14 is formed in one side of the baffle 7, the clamping rod 13 is movably clamped with the clamping groove 14, an inclined plate 15 is fixedly mounted at the bottom of the other side of the vertical plate 12, a sleeve plate 16 is sleeved on the inclined plate 15 in a sliding mode, and a button 17 is fixedly mounted at the top of the sleeve plate 16.
The utility model discloses in, fixed mounting has the one end of guide bar 9 on the 6 bottom inner walls in vertical groove, and baffle 7 slides and cup joints in the 9 outsides of guide bar, leads to baffle 7.
The utility model discloses in, fixed mounting has same fixed plate 19 on 11 top inner walls of transverse groove and the bottom inner wall, and fixed plate 19 slides and cup joints in the kelly 13 outside, leads kelly 13.
The utility model discloses in, riser 12 one side fixedly connected with reset spring 20's one end, reset spring 20's the other end and fixed plate 19 one side fixed connection lead riser 12.
The utility model discloses in, seted up vertical hole 18 on the 11 top inner walls of transverse groove, lagging 16 slidable mounting leads lagging 16 in vertical hole 18.
The utility model discloses in, the equal fixed mounting in 2 bottom four corners of unable adjustment base has the backup pad, and the equal fixed mounting in four backup pad bottoms has sucking disc 10, is convenient for place fixed 2 to unable adjustment base fixedly.
In the utility model, when in use, the fixing base 2 is fixed by the sucker 10, the button 17 drives the sleeve plate 16 to move downwards by pressing the button 17, the sleeve plate 16 drives the inclined plate 15 and the vertical plate 12 to move towards one side far away from the baffle 7 by sliding fit with the inclined plate 15, the vertical plate 12 drives the clamping rod 13 to move towards one side to separate from connection with the clamping groove 14, thereby separating from fixing the baffle 7, then the baffle 7 can be driven to move downwards by pressing the baffle 7 downwards to separate from blocking the scanning gun body 1, then the charging head 3 is separated from the charging slot 5 by moving the scanning gun body 1 transversely, thereby taking out the scanning gun body 1 to facilitate scanning work, after the scanning work is finished, the vertical plate 12 is driven to move towards one side by pressing the button 17 and stretch the reset spring 20, then the scanning gun body 1 is placed at the top of the fixing base 2 and pushes the baffle 7 to move downwards and compress the supporting spring 8, then promote the scanning rifle body 1 to the one side motion that is close to the picture peg 4 that charges makes the head 3 that charges insert the slot 5 that charges in, thereby in order to realize charging to the scanning rifle body 1, when the head 3 that charges inserts the slot 5 that charges completely, baffle 7 upward movement under supporting spring 8's elastic action, thereby it is fixed to it through blockking to the scanning rifle body 1, riser 12 drives kelly 13 reverse slip and card income draw-in groove 14 under reset spring 20's elastic action, fix baffle 7, thereby guarantee the fixed stability to the scanning rifle body 1, prevent that the mistake from touching and cause its to drop, the security of using has been promoted.
